693019
0000000000000000000cfe2dd935822c93f96179ca964c810c09df7783419292
Time
07-28-2021 12:39:12 (Local)
Sponsored
Transaction Fees
0
BTC
Confirmations
237530
Total Amounts
0 USDT
Transaction Counts
0
Previous Block:
Merkle Root:
8bbeb5aaa07b60879aa0c232a215740c19bc92e396c5c69cf345a284df00c331
APIs